Transaction c34edc0822585bc024210af9975e20476b16a768e82b19f1eb17701bc6ad58ad
1 Input
2 Outputs
- c34edc0822585bc024210af9975e20476b16a768e82b19f1eb17701bc6ad58ad:0
- c34edc0822585bc024210af9975e20476b16a768e82b19f1eb17701bc6ad58ad:1
value 1385758
address 38FidaRVcRZy7SabvcT7k26SG4BKVcdWeo
value 50516
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c